What is an AI case study?

An AI case study documents a concrete business challenge, the chosen solution, integration into processes and systems and verifiable results, beyond a model or demo.

It is meaningful when prerequisites, quality criteria and limitations are visible, helping you assess what applies to your business.

Which AI use cases suit SMEs?

Start with clearly bounded, frequent, knowledge-intensive tasks: document search and review, service enquiries, classification, image recognition or preparing steps across systems.

Technology alone is not decisive. Assess expected value, data quality, frequency, error risk and integration effort.

How is AI project success measured?

Metrics come from the process and are set before development. Depending on the application, they may include handling time, accuracy, answer quality, resolution rate, error rate, adoption or the share of correctly prepared cases.

A baseline, representative tests and expert acceptance make assessment reliable. For generative AI, “sounds good” is not enough.

How long does AI implementation take?

It mainly depends on data access, process scope, interfaces and protection needs. A bounded prototype can often demonstrate viability within a few weeks.

Production also needs testing, roles and permissions, robust interfaces, monitoring, documentation and employee involvement. Planning should distinguish prototyping from production rollout.

How does evival protect confidential business data?

Protection is designed for the use case, including data minimisation, controlled access, suitable deployment, encryption, logging and clear retention rules.

We select models and providers by task and protection requirements. Where errors could have serious consequences, we add safeguards and human approvals.

Can AI integrate with existing ERP, CRM and DMS solutions?

Yes. Through APIs and secure interfaces, AI can use system information, return results or prepare defined work steps.

AI receives only necessary permissions. Existing roles, access rules and checks remain authoritative; critical actions can require human confirmation.

What distinguishes a prototype from production AI?

A prototype tests feasibility: does the approach work with realistic data and defined test cases? Its scope may deliberately be limited.

Operations add reliable interfaces, identities, permissions, quality monitoring, error handling, privacy, documentation and clear responsibilities. These unseen elements turn a demo into a dependable system.

When does RAG make sense for business knowledge?

RAG suits answers based on approved, regularly changing company sources. Before answering, the system retrieves relevant content and provides it as context to the language model.

That does not automatically make answers correct. Sources, access controls, good documents and systematic evaluation remain essential.

When do AI agents make sense, and when not?

Agents suit goals requiring several traceable steps, such as finding information, checking a case and preparing an action. Tools, rights and stopping rules must be narrowly defined.

For fixed, fully rule-based workflows, conventional automation is often simpler and more reliable. Combining workflows, software logic and AI may be best.

What role do employees play in an AI case study?

Employees know exceptions, quality standards and real bottlenecks. Their experience helps select use cases, build tests and assess results.

Early involvement improves usability and adoption. The aim is a sensible division of tasks between people and systems.

Use case selection

What makes an AI use case viable?

The best projects combine a real bottleneck with accessible data, measurable quality and manageable risk.

  1. 01

    Relevant problem

    The task regularly consumes time, causes errors or prevents effective use of knowledge.

  2. 02

    Suitable data

    Required documents, images or case data are available, lawfully usable and sufficiently representative.

  3. 03

    Verifiable result

    Quality and business value can be assessed with concrete tests and metrics.

  4. 04

    Manageable risk

    Error consequences are understood and controlled through roles, safeguards and human approvals.
